Overview

Senior DAC Architect and Lead at Omni Design Technologies, Inc. DAC architect and development lead focusing on high-performance digital-to-analog converters. The successful candidate will work with customers to understand requirements, and will lead the development of high performance transistor level design starting from initial specification, through design and layout supervision, silicon evaluation and characterization to final product introduction to market. Responsibilities

Lead the development of high-performance transistor-level circuit designs for DACs from initial specification through design and layout supervision. Collaborate with customers to define product requirements that address market needs. Supervise layout and silicon evaluation, characterization, and verification activities to ensure conformance with specifications. Work with cross-functional teams to bring designs to production and market. Qualifications

10+ years of experience in high-performance analog or mixed-signal IC development in advanced CMOS processes Thorough familiarity with high-speed, high-resolution ADC/DAC data converter design techniques; experience in building blocks such as bandgap reference, op-amp, comparators, oscillators, DLL, PLL, etc. Track record of successfully taking designs to production Ability to work with customers to define products that address needs Experience evaluating silicon on bench and familiarity with standard lab equipment Strong intuitive and analytical understanding of transistor-level circuit design including noise and mismatch analysis Experience with analog and digital behavioral modeling and/or synthesis of digital control blocks Familiar with Cadence schematic capture, Virtuoso, Spectre and/or HSPICE MATLAB understanding preferred but not mandatory Familiar with designing circuits for electromigration and ESD compliance in submicron CMOS Experience with layout parasitic extraction tools and layout-dependent impairments in advanced CMOS processes Ability to work independently and create/adapt to schedules Strong written and verbal communication skills with the ability to work with teams across locations About Omni Design
